Not every game may work with gngeo. Especially more recent games can give issues. SNK later tried to copyprotect there games more and more to prevent piracy.

I play emulation since 1999, I have actualy mame cab full working, but gngeo doesn't recognize my neogeo bios, what file do you have in bios ?

I have tese:

Code:
[kybo@kybocpu neo_bios]$ ls
000-lo.lo         sp-45.sp1         uni-bios_1_1.rom   uni-bios_2_2.rom
asia-s3.rom       sp-e.sp1          uni-bios_1_2o.rom  uni-bios_2_3o.rom
sfix.sfix         sp-j2.sp1         uni-bios_1_2.rom   uni-bios_2_3.rom
sm1.sm1           sp-s2.sp1         uni-bios_1_3.rom   usa_2slt.bin
sp1.jipan.1024    sp-s.sp1          uni-bios_2_0.rom   vs-bios.rom
sp-1v1_3db8c.bin  uni-bios_1_0.rom  uni-bios_2_1.rom
[kybo@kybocpu neo_bios]$
 
Posts: 173 | Thanked: 21 times | Joined on Sep 2010 @ Rio de Janeiro
#57
You sure your bios are in the right location? What message comes if run from Xterminal? You need to have all the 23 Main neogeo bios.

Google neogeo.zip. It is 1.2 MB size.
 
Posts: 38 | Thanked: 2 times | Joined on Nov 2010
#58
thank you my friend,

I renamed sfix.sfix to sfix.sfx and now its ok !
